=Construction= There are two general approaches to constructing a starship. First is to select a hull size and fit all of the equipment into this select hull size. The other is to select all the equipment, see what size of hull is required, and wrap that around it. ===Hull size=== {|style="float:right" !Military<br/>Name!!Civilian<br/>Name!!Size<br/>(spaces)!!Structure!!Handling!!Max<br/>Sensor!!Crew |- |Fighter||Shuttle||10 - 50||10 - 30||-0||+0||1 |- |Escort||Yacht||50 - 150 ||30 - 50||-2||+0||1 - 2 |- |Corvette||Explorer||150 - 500||50 - 65||-4||+1||2 - 7 |- |Destoryer||Trader||500 - 2,000||65 - 85||-6||+2||7 - 14 |- |Cruiser||Freighter||2,000 - 10,000||85 - 110||-8||+3||15 - 30 |- |Battleship||Carrier||10,000 - 40,000||110 - 130||-10||+4||30 - 60 |} When selecting a hull, either as a starting point or as because you have a selection of equipment you need to enclose, select the hull size in spaces. The approximate size of the hull determines the handing and maximum sensor rating. The exact size of the ship determines the basic structure rating and the minimum number of crew required, ===Armor=== All ships come with a basic armor rating of Durability 5. Additional layers of armor may be added to improve the Durability. Each layer of armor takes a certain percentage of the existing spaces in a ship for the additional bulkheads, bracing and mass of the armor. ===Drives=== The normal space drive provides both acceleration and handling. Drives are rated in point, each point providing a +1 to either acceleration or handing. This boost is usually decided at design time, though some drives may provide dynamic bonuses, allowing the pilot to shift the point in the drive from acceleration to handing or back. Each dirve point takes a percentage of the ships hull spaces, ===Weapons=== Weapons require weapons mounts, a combiation of hull reinforcements, power routing, and control connections specifically designed for weapons. A ship has 1 mount for each 100 spaces for free, and additional mounts may be added, each mount takes 1 space. Weapons don't take any additional space, though some weapons will require more than one "mount" to emplace them on a ship. ===Sensors=== {|style="float:right" !Sensor<br/>Bonus!!Size |- | +1 || 100 |- | +2 || 200 |- | +3 || 400 |- | +4 || 800 |} All ships come with a basis set of operation sensors and controls. The main limitation of sensors is the area for the sensor antenna, which require large ships to effectivly mount, even if the equipment isn't of large size. === Crew and Passengers === A ship may have any number of crew, but must have at least as the minimum crew requirements shown on the hull table. The minimum crew is all engineering and command staff, and if additinal crew are requred for damage control parties, gunners, stewards, they must be added. Ships intended for short term use (like fighter craft or shuttles) require one space for each crew member. This include the seat, all required controls, life support system, and access hatch. Ships inteded for long term use require five spaces for each crew member; one space for their control station, one for their bunk, and three for common access space (fresher, corridors, bunk room access). This space include the life support system with air, heat, lights and water. There are airlocks for access to the ship (one per 10 crew, minimum of 1). Short term passenger access requires two spaces, one for the passenger seat, plus one for the passenger to access the seat. This include the life support, basic heat, light and air. Long term passengers require six spaces, three for common access space (corridors, etc) and three for a small room. Many ships combine these small passenger rooms into two or three passenger suites.
